Let the bias tape serve as fine details and beautiful finishes on edges and cut-outs.   Good to know about bias tape Bias tape has the (almost) magical ability to adapt to many fabrics. As the name suggests, it's cut on the bias, therefore naturally following your curves, necklines, corners, and edges. This results in a beautiful finish.   How to sew on bias tape Bias tape is for sewing on curves, corners, and straight stretches. When sewing the bias tape onto your project, use straight stitches with approximately 2.5 cm stitch length. While sewing, don't pull or stretch it. Allow it to naturally align with the edge for a neat result.   TIP When you start sewing your bias tape, fold approximately 2 cm inwards, so it's double-layered. When you finish, tuck the other end's fold over your folded start. The same principle applies when extending a bias tape.
